Conchae
Curved bones in the nasal cavity that help to filter, warm, and moisten the air before it enters the lungs.
Tracheotomy
A surgically made opening in the trachea through which a person will breathe.
Intubation
The insertion of a tube into a patient's airway to maintain an open airway or administer certain drugs.
